                  Flash penetration rate (I won't giggle I swear!)

                  I've looked to a number of sources for this and see anything from 65% to 80% listed. When I ran a simple auto refresh that waited for a small flash movie to load and refreshed to a non-flash page if the flash didn't load, I saw about 40% of the people getting pushed to the non-flash. So I figure if you factor 5 - 10% of the people in having hit the refresh because of super slow connection, not just missing Flash, you end up around that 65% mark.
